Philadelphia Eagles vs Kansas City Chiefs Under 48.5 (-110)
While both teams boast elite offenses, their postseason performances suggest a defensive battle is more likely. Philadelphia’s defense has been its backbone all season, finishing as the league’s top-ranked unit and maintaining that dominance in the playoffs. Over three postseason games, the Eagles have limited opponents to 351.3 yards and just 19.0 points per game, forcing 10 turnovers in that span.
Kansas City has matched that defensive intensity but has been more vulnerable against the run. The Chiefs have surrendered 355.0 yards per game and 20.0 points per contest across their two playoff appearances. However, their biggest issue has been on offense, where they’ve managed just 580 total yards despite scoring 55 points, indicating potential regression against a stronger Eagles defense.
Additionally, Philadelphia’s offensive explosion in the NFC Championship Game (55 points) is unlikely to be repeated against a more disciplined Chiefs unit. Given both teams’ defensive focus and Kansas City’s offensive inconsistency, this game is set up to stay under 48.5 points.

Travis Kelce Anytime Touchdown (+130)
Few players shine brighter in big-game moments than Travis Kelce, and with Patrick Mahomes under pressure, Kelce remains his most reliable target. Whether breaking off routes or finding open space in the red zone, the star tight end consistently delivers when it matters most.
While Kelce’s touchdown numbers dipped during the regular season, his Super Bowl track record speaks for itself. Across four Super Bowl appearances, he has amassed 350 receiving yards and two touchdowns, proving his ability to rise to the occasion. The future Hall of Famer also found the end zone against Philly in Super Bowl LVII. Given his chemistry with Mahomes and the Chiefs’ knack for scheming him open in crucial moments, there’s substantial value in backing Kelce to score again on Sunday night.

Isiah Pacheco 25+ Rushing Yards (+114)
While Isiah Pacheco hasn’t looked as explosive as he did earlier in the season, the Chiefs will need him to regain that burst in Super Bowl LIX. Kareem Hunt has provided stability in the backfield, but Pacheco brings an extra level of speed and elusiveness that Kansas City’s offense has been missing since his injury.
Despite the limited carries he’s received, Pacheco has a history of efficiency against Philadelphia’s defense, averaging 5.1 yards per carry in their last Super Bowl meeting. If he can replicate that production level, even with a smaller workload, reaching 25 rushing yards becomes an attainable mark, making this a solid value play.
